Which logarithmic equation is equivalent to the exponential equation below?

E^a=38.47

A. In a=38.47
B. Log a 38.47=3.65
C. In 38.47= a
D. Log38.47 3.65=e

Answer:

C) a = ln (38.47).

Explanation:

Given :
E^(a) = 38.47

To find : Which logarithmic equation is equivalent to the exponential equation.

Solution : We have given that :
E^(a) = 38.47.

Taking natural logarithm both sides


log_(e)(E^(a)) = log(38.47).

By the logarithm rule:
log_(a)(a^(n))= n ;
log_(e)(e) = 1.=1.

Then , a = ln (38.47).

Therefore,C) a = ln (38.47).
